Julie...At Home is an LP album by Julie London, released by Liberty Records under catalog number LRP-3152 as a monophonic recording in 1960, and later in stereo under catalog number LST-7152 the same year.Recorded in Julie London's living room.This 1960s pop-album-related article is a stub.You can help Wikipedia by expanding it.
